On this WGNS Action Line episode, host Scott Walker welcomes Rutherford County Mayor Joe Carr for a candid, heartfelt conversation about his recent horseback riding accident that left him with nine broken ribs, a lacerated liver, and a partially collapsed lung. Mayor Carr walks listeners through what happened on the farm that day, the emergency response from Rutherford County Fire & Rescue, EMS, and law enforcement, and the life-saving care he received at Ascension Saint Thomas Rutherford and Vanderbilt’s Trauma Center.

Beyond the dramatic details, Carr reflects on faith, pain, humility, and what he’s learned about community, family, and leadership through suffering. He talks about the emotional and spiritual side of recovery, why no one should “go it alone,” and how this experience deepened his appreciation for first responders and county staff who kept government moving while he healed. Scott and the Mayor also touch on Rutherford County’s growing public safety network—new EMS stations, fire halls, public health and safety buildings, and how the county is working to support first responders without raising property taxes. The episode closes with Carr’s determination to “get back in the saddle” and his Thanksgiving-season message of gratitude to Rutherford County residents.
